How to Plan for Major Home Expenses?

List all major home expenses expected in the next 1 to 10 years

Estimate the cost of each expense

Prioritize expenses by urgency and importance

Create a dedicated home maintenance savings fund

Set monthly savings targets for each expense

Automate transfers into the savings fund

Review and update estimates annually

Get multiple quotes before scheduling major repairs or replacements

Build a contingency buffer for unexpected costs

Separate routine maintenance from major capital expenses

Track the age and condition of major home systems and appliances

Schedule preventive maintenance to extend equipment life

Use a sinking fund for predictable large expenses

Avoid using high-interest debt for planned home costs

Compare financing options only when necessary

Keep records of warranties, receipts, and service history

Plan for seasonal expenses such as HVAC, roof, and gutter maintenance

Include property taxes, insurance increases, and utility upgrades in planning

Reassess the plan after major life or income changes
